It is the responsibility of the contractor to perform or coordinate all <br />necessary utility connections and relocations from existing utility locations <br />to the proposed building, as well as to all onsite amenities. These <br />connections include but are not limited to water, sanitary sewer, cable TV, <br />telephone, gas, electric, site lighting, etc. <br />2. All service connections shall be performed in accordance with state and <br />local standard specifications for construction. Utility connections (sanitary <br />sewer, watermain, and storm sewer) may require a permit from the City. <br />3. The contractor shall verify the elevations at proposed connections to <br />existing utilities prior to any demolition or excavation. All elevations with an <br />asterisk (*) shall be field verified. If elevations vary significantly, notify the <br />Engineer for further instructions. <br />4. The contractor shall notify all appropriate engineering departments and <br />utility companies 72 hours prior to construction. All necessary precautions <br />shall be made to avoid damage to existing utilities. <br />5. Storm sewer requires testing in accordance with Minnesota plumbing code <br />4714.1107 where located within 10 feet of waterlines or the building. <br />6. HDPE storm sewer piping shall meet ASTM F2306 and fittings shall meet <br />ASTM D3212 joint pressure test. Installation shall meet ASTM C2321. <br />7. Maintain a minimum of 8' of cover over all water lines and sanitary sewer <br />lines. Where 8' of cover is not provided, install 2" rigid polystyrene insulation <br />(MN/DOT 3760) with a thermal resistance of at least 5 and a compressive <br />strength of at least 25 psi. Insulation shall be 8' wide, centered over pipe <br />with 6" sand cushion between pipe and insulation. Where depth is less <br />than 5', use 4" of insulation. <br />8. Install water lines 18" above sewers. Where the sewer is less than 18" <br />below the water line (or above), install sewer piping of materials approved <br />for inside building use for 10 feet on each side of the crossing. <br />9.
